麻豆小视频在线观看_中文黄色一级片_久久久成人精品_成片免费观看视频大全_午夜精品久久久久久久99热浪潮_成人一区二区三区四区

首頁 > 語言 > JavaScript > 正文

JavaScript中數組的合并以及排序實現示例

2024-05-06 16:24:51
字體:
來源:轉載
供稿:網友

這篇文章主要介紹了JavaScript中數組的合并以及排序實現示例,是JavaScript入門學習中的基礎知識,需要的朋友可以參考下

合并兩個數組 - concat()

源代碼:

 

 
  1. <!DOCTYPE html> 
  2. <html> 
  3. <body> 
  4. <p id="demo">點擊按鈕合并數組。</p> 
  5. <button onclick="myFunction()">點我</button> 
  6. <script> 
  7. function myFunction() 
  8. var hege = ["Cecilie""Lone"]; 
  9. var stale = ["Emil""Tobias""Linus"]; 
  10. var children = hege.concat(stale); 
  11. var x=document.getElementById("demo"); 
  12. x.innerHTML=children; 
  13. </script> 
  14. </body> 
  15. </html> 

測試結果:

 

 
  1. Cecilie,Lone,Emil,Tobias,Linus 

合并三個數組 - concat()

源代碼:

 

 
  1. <!DOCTYPE html> 
  2. <html> 
  3. <body> 
  4.  
  5. <script> 
  6.  
  7. var parents = ["Jani""Tove"]; 
  8. var brothers = ["Stale""Kai Jim""Borge"]; 
  9. var children = ["Cecilie""Lone"]; 
  10. var family = parents.concat(brothers, children); 
  11. document.write(family); 
  12.  
  13. </script> 
  14.  
  15. </body> 
  16. </html> 

測試結果:

 

 
  1. Jani,Tove,Stale,Kai Jim,Borge,Cecilie,Lone 

數組排序(按字母順序升序)- sort()

源代碼:

 

  1. <!DOCTYPE html> 
  2. <html> 
  3. <body> 
  4. <p id="demo">Click the button to sort the array.</p> 
  5. <button onclick="myFunction()">Try it</button> 
  6. <script> 
  7. function myFunction() 
  8. var fruits = ["Banana""Orange""Apple""Mango"]; 
  9. fruits.sort(); 
  10. var x=document.getElementById("demo"); 
  11. x.innerHTML=fruits; 
  12. </script> 
  13. </body> 
  14. </html>  

測試結果:

 

 
  1. Apple,Banana,Mango,Orange 

數字排序(按數字順序升序)- sort()

源代碼:

 

 
  1. <!DOCTYPE html> 
  2. <html> 
  3. <body> 
  4. <p id="demo">Click the button to sort the array.</p> 
  5. <button onclick="myFunction()">Try it</button> 
  6. <script> 
  7. function myFunction() 
  8. var points = [40,100,1,5,25,10]; 
  9. points.sort(function(a,b){return a-b}); 
  10. var x=document.getElementById("demo"); 
  11. x.innerHTML=points; 
  12. </script> 
  13. </body> 
  14. </html>  

測試結果:

 

 
  1. 1,5,10,25,40,100 

數字排序(按數字順序降序)- sort()

源代碼:

 

 
  1. <!DOCTYPE html> 
  2. <html> 
  3. <body> 
  4. <p id="demo">Click the button to sort the array.</p> 
  5. <button onclick="myFunction()">Try it</button> 
  6. <script> 
  7. function myFunction() 
  8. var points = [40,100,1,5,25,10]; 
  9. points.sort(function(a,b){return b-a}); 
  10. var x=document.getElementById("demo"); 
  11. x.innerHTML=points; 
  12. </script> 
  13. </body> 
  14. </html> 

測試結果:

 

 
  1. 100,40,25,10,5,1 

將一個數組中的元素的順序反轉排序 - reverse()

源代碼:

 

 
  1. <!DOCTYPE html> 
  2. <html> 
  3. <body> 
  4. <p id="demo">Click the button to reverse the order of the elements in the array.</p> 
  5. <button onclick="myFunction()">Try it</button> 
  6. <script> 
  7. var fruits = ["Banana""Orange""Apple""Mango"]; 
  8. function myFunction() 
  9. fruits.reverse(); 
  10. var x=document.getElementById("demo"); 
  11. x.innerHTML=fruits; 
  12. </script> 
  13. </body> 
  14. </html>  

測試結果:

 

 
  1. Mango,Apple,Orange,Banana 

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表

圖片精選

主站蜘蛛池模板: 空姐毛片| 一级成人毛片 | 亚洲射逼 | 黄色一级毛片免费看 | 亚洲一级片在线观看 | mmmwww| 国产色91 | www.99tv| 一级黄色毛片播放 | 久久人人爽人人爽人人片av高请 | 亚洲字幕av| 草久在线 | 成人在线免费看 | 成人一区二区三区四区 | 成人一级免费视频 | 色蜜桃av| 视频一区二区三区在线播放 | 精品国产一区二区久久 | 日韩深夜视频 | 久久人人爽人人爽人人片av免费 | 国产美女精品视频 | 精品国产1区2区3区 免费国产 | 欧美一级三级在线观看 | 日本中文字幕网址 | 久久亚洲国产精品 | 黄色网址在线视频 | 国产伦精品一区二区三区 | 久草在线视频精品 | 国产精品99一区二区 | 久久亚洲第一 | 欧美一级黄色片在线观看 | 亚洲码无人客一区二区三区 | 中文在线观看www | 午夜视频在线观看免费视频 | 亚洲国产网址 | 亚洲成人精品区 | 91在线观看 | 久久久久电影网站 | 成人免费毛片片v | 激情小说色 | 日韩一级网站 |